The process that allows oxygen and carbon dioxide to transfer is called respiration. In the lungs, oxygen is taken in from the air we breathe and is exchanged for carbon dioxide that is then exhaled. This gas exchange occurs in the alveoli, tiny air sacs in the lungs, where oxygen enters the bloodstream and carbon dioxide leaves it.
